Output e8620998d140e7826bc31af563c5368d7a343e2a3008e2c8d7e5687481d1d68c:3

value
2975699
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 07f3e1bf70d9d448456846c890c46dbcd9ed57f42271b72e2ff8a8dbbf86f813
address
bc1pqle7r0msm82ys3tggmyfp3rdhnv764l5yfcmwt30lz5dh0uxlqfss6pefy
transaction
e8620998d140e7826bc31af563c5368d7a343e2a3008e2c8d7e5687481d1d68c
spent
true